Core Concepts and Calculations
The scaffolding load calculator incorporates multiple critical factors to determine safe working conditions:
1. Base Load Calculation
The base load is calculated using the volumetric space of the scaffolding structure:
- Volume = Height × Length × Width
- Base Load = Volume × 25 kg/m³ (standard scaffolding weight density)
2. Live Loads
- Worker Load = Number of Workers × 100 kg (including tools and PPE)
- Material Load = Direct input of construction materials weight
3. Environmental Forces
Wind load calculation follows the standard pressure equation:
- Wind Load = 0.613 × V² × A / 1000
- Where V is wind speed in m/s
- A is the exposed area (height × length)
Safety Factors and Standards
The calculator implements different safety factors based on location:
- Indoor installations: 2.0× safety factor
- Outdoor installations: 2.5× safety factor (accounting for environmental variables)
These align with international standards and ConstructKit's best practices for construction safety.
Understanding Load Limits
Total load must consider:
- Dead loads (structure weight)
- Live loads (workers and materials)
- Environmental loads (wind, snow if applicable)
- Dynamic loads (movement and vibration)
